WebApr 25, 2024 · 5. Palm Jumeirah. Dubai hosts one of the largest man-made islands in the world, the Palm Jumeirah, the first of the series of Palm Islands in Dubai, well-known for its palm-tree shaped design. The Palm … WebJun 2, 2024 · In 2003, a new feather has been announced to add to its feather, “The World”, man-made island; a project worth more than a billion. The shape of this man-made island has just resembled the map of the earth. With three already constructed man-made islands, “The World” was planned to be the tourist’s hotspot as it is just a short ride ...

WebMay 7, 2024 · Man-made islands, or artificial islands, are ones made by man rather than created by nature. They can be created by expanding on existing islets or constructing on reefs.
